Aftermarket Deck Memory Wiring Question
I am installing a aftermarket CD Player in my 1994 E320. I'm using a harness adapter so I do not have to cut any wires. I hooked up all of the wires and everything works good except the FM presets are not saved and it does not automatically come on when I start the car (I have to press the ON button)
It makes me think the constant power wire is not hooked up but I can't find a wire that will work. Any suggestions? Thanks, Don

the yelllow wire ont he aftermarket unit should be hooked up to constant power, and the red wire should be hooked up to the accessory wire.
I ran my own seperate fused line in my car from the battery to the radio for the memory wire, not because I couldn;t find it, but because I wanted to. I am not using a harness adapter, I simply wired directly in, but my car had an aftermarket system before. Sounds to me like the memory wire is not hooked up. Alon
